Transaction 207016c18fadbc5835cb84f85a0836312e5dff4c2bd2daae28f698fee4928a08

100 Input
1 Outputs
  • 207016c18fadbc5835cb84f85a0836312e5dff4c2bd2daae28f698fee4928a08:0
  • value  2822711875
    address  12cgpFdJViXbwHbhrA3TuW1EGnL25Zqc3P